Kinetic-Spectrophotometric Determination of Traces of Osmium by Its Catalytic Effect on the Oxidation of Pyrogallol Red by Hydrogen Peroxide

&
Pages 1771-1785 | Received 11 Jan 1993, Accepted 11 Mar 1993, Published online: 23 Sep 2006
 

Abstract

A Kinetic-spectrophotometric method for the determination of ultra-trace amounts of osmium(VIII) is described. It is based on the catalytic action of osmium(VIII) on the oxidation of pyrogallol red with hydrogen peroxide, yielding a colorless product in neutral medium. The reaction is followed spectrophotometrically by measuring the rate of change in absorbance at 540 nm and 30°C. Os(VIII) in the range 0.005 -100 ng.ml−1 can be determined. The proposed method is hardly subject to interferences. The relative standard deviation is 1.5% for 1 ng.ml−1 of Os(VIII). The kinetic parameters of the catalyzed and uncatalyzed reactions are reported. The detection limit is 1 pg.ml−1.
